Oxytocin Receptor Antagonists Small Molecules and Peptides
Oxytocin receptors (OT) are G-protein-coupled receptors that mediate parturition and lactation. They are closely related to vasopressin receptors. Oxytocin receptors are coupled to Gq/11 proteins and are localized to the myoepithelial cells of the mammary gland, and are also expressed in the myometrium and endometrium of the uterus at the end of pregnancy.
